Futurama Season 12 Finally Gives Leela A Leading Role In An Episode

After Sidelining Her For Several Episodes

Hulu’sFuturamarevival has done well with all of the show’s characters except for one: Leela. For some reason,it seems that Leela has been sidelined a lot throughout the revival seasons, with the show constantly mischaracterizing her and putting her in the background of many storylines. It is almost as ifFuturamahas forgotten that Leela is one of the main characters, as side characters like Zoidberg, Hermes, Amy, and Farnsworth have had more episodes focused on them throughout the two seasons than Leela has.

Luckily,Futuramaseason 12, episode 5 finally fixes this. In the episode, the guys from Planet Express go to a Fyre Festival parody called Inferno Festival, leaving Leela behind. This causes Leela to realize that she needs to make a friend group of her own. The episode mainly focuses on Leela’s attempts to create this new friend group and maintain it, with Leela and many ofFuturama’s most notable female side characters going on an adventure of their own. The episode even culminates with Leela facing off against an evil AI chatbot, adding some excitement to her big season 12 story.

Leela Has Been Sidelined Throughout Hulu’s Futurama Revival

She Feels Out Of Character In Previous Episodes

Leela was owed a storyline like the one seen inFuturamaseason 12, episode 5, as she has mostly been sidelined throughout Hulu’sFuturamarevival. Admittedly, she did get some focus early inFuturamaseason 11, as the show’s earliest episodes were focused on developing Fry and Leela’s relationship. Outside of her relationship with Fry, however, she hasn’t done much,with this being an especially noticeable problem in season 12.

Leela is just another member of the heist in episode 1, she gets killed off in episode 2, she is mind-controlled in episode 3, andLeela’s environmentalism and activism are completely ignored in episode 4. Leela hasn’t had a major role in any of these episodes, leavingFuturamafans like myself hoping that she would get the spotlight once again soon. Season 12’s lack of focus on Leela has been incredibly strange due to her being the show’s female lead, and while she can’t be the main focus of every episode, she needs to have a greater presence more often.

Futurama Season 12, Episode 5 Sets Up The Perfect Way To Tell More Leela Stories

She Now Has Her Own Cast Of Supporting Characters

Although Leela has been ignored up until now,Futuramaseason 12, episode 5 sets up the perfect way to tell more Leela-centric stories. The reason that Leela has been sidelined so much in season 12 is that she doesn’t have a particularly close relationship with Farnsworth, Bender, orotherFuturamacharacterswho have been the focus of episodes so far. In the past, she could really only be used if the episode was solely about her or about Fry, two things that the show has moved away from in its revival seasons.

However,giving Leela an entirely new friend group in episode 5 was the perfect solution to this. Even if the episode is focused on one of the aforementioned characters, everyFuturamaepisode now has the potential to feature a B-story focused on Leela’s new friend group. This means that she is no longer forced to stand around in the background if a story can’t figure out what to do with her, finally offering Leela a chance at being a leadFuturamacharacter once again.

Futurama is an animated science fiction series that follows Philip J. Fry, a pizza delivery boy from late-20th-century New York City. He is accidentally cryogenically frozen for a thousand years and becomes an employee at Planet Express, a delivery service in the retro-futuristic 31st century.
